Частота дискретизации AVAudioSession <48 кГц? - PullRequest
0 голосов
/ 02 марта 2019

У нас есть приложение VOIP, которое обычно передает аудиопакеты с частотой дискретизации 32 кГц.Для того, что может показаться разумным, мы обычно устанавливаем предпочтительную частоту дискретизации AVAudioSessions 32 кГц.На более поздних iPhone (например, iPhone XS) мы обнаружили, что громкая связь больше не воспроизводится и не искажается при использовании частоты дискретизации 32 кГц.Но аудио сеанс, похоже, с радостью принимает (с подтверждением обратного чтения) предпочтительный параметр SampleRate, равный 32 кГц.Я читал, что кодек iPhone 6S (и, возможно, более поздние устройства) поддерживает только частоты дискретизации 48 кГц ... но если это так, почему бы iOS не переопределить setPreferredSampleRate?

...